#1c585c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c585c is composed of 11% red, 34.5%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.6% cyan, 4.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 183.8 degrees, a saturation of 53.3% and a lightness of 23.5%. #1c585c color hex could be obtained by blending #38b0b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#1c585c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f2fafb is the lightest one.
